The Beasts of The Mesozoic: Triceratops Horridus is a meticulously crafted 1/18 scale dinosaur action figure, measuring 18 inches long and 8 inches tall. With 20 points of articulation, this hand-painted collectible offers both stunning detail and dynamic posing options. It includes a scientifically accurate design, a full-color background display insert, and a collector card, making it a must-have for enthusiasts and collectors alike.

Beuatiful figuers...if you have a workshop to fix them.
Okay, so the figure looks awesome, but mine came with a broken foot too. I do extensive modeling and for me it was a simple fix with a jewelers drill and an aluminum dowel. I almost gave it a 4 star review just because the figure is beautiful. Then I considered that most people don't have the tools to fix it on their desks, and considering the price of the figure such terrible quality control is inexcusable. Then I was going to drop to a two star review, but unfortunately I'd already ordered six other BOTM figures from various sources to the tune of over $700 before the Triceratops had arrived. So far three have come in two of which are fine. The Daspletosaurus came with the peg on the display stand cut too long and set at an angle. My display cases are mounted to the walls and slightly off the floor to keep their contents secure. I was sitting in my loot cave and the Daspletosaurus just fell off it's stand. Not onto the floor, the cases are fully enclosed, just onto it's side. Because of the defective stand and a 4 inch topple there are now paint chips on it's knee and hip. To be fair, I can fix this too with little effort, but for the price I shouldn't be doing repairs on 50% of the BOTM figures that have arrived so far. Full disclosure, They are beautiful figures with amazing sculpts and I'm not even considering cancelling the other three I'd ordered, but there's really no excuse for such poor QC on a premium product and if you don't have a modeling shop with thousands of dollars in tools I wouldn't recommend BOTM figures.

Awesome figure!
I'm very happy with mine! There have been some issues with the feet sticking and breaking. My feet did stick but didn't break because it was easily rectified with hot water (this has been an extremely common issue with high end collector's action figures for decades).
